PARIS, January 22 /PRNewswire/ -- - Moscow Is Top Market Choice; Followed by Prague, Brussels
Despite the weak economy that continues to affect most European markets, real estate investors remain cautiously optimistic about the industry's course over the next year, with many anticipating "modestly good" profitability, according to Emerging Trends in Real Estate(R) Europe 2004, just released by the Urban Land Institute (ULI) and PricewaterhouseCoopers LLP.
